Rail logistician SETG enhances blocktrain schedule

SETG reckons with slight volume growth for 2009
 

Responding to the strong demand for industrial round timber, the Salzburger EisenbahnTransportLogistik GmbH has been operating more ECCO-Shuttle block trains with round timber since June 2009. In cooperation with SNCF Fret, the windthrow-wood that had been caused by a storm in January in southern France is carried away by use of private wagon sets. The trains are regularly serving consumers in Germany and Austria. 

Moreover, new block trains on the routes Poland – Germany and Slovakia – Austria were added to the schedule. The round timber wagon fleet of SETG was enlarged by more than 100 large-volume units. 

SETG is acting as a rail logistics enterprise throughout Europe. It operates block trains with own charter locomotives and special round timber wagons, suitable for transportations of round timber, trimmed timber and wood chips. In addition the company offers solutions for shipments with individual wagons from eastern Europe to Austria and Germany. 

In 2008 SETG controlled transportations of around 2.1 million tons of wood products. In spite of the economic crisis, which also affected the timber industry, Managing Director Gunther Pitterka expects volumes to grow slightly this year.
